There are also a series of podcast interviews with owner Penny Chenery here: http://www.bloodhorse.com/horse-racing/articles/tag/secretariat-podcasts
The interviews are very "human" and include an admission that he ran in many races for "the money", how she wished her father had been still alive to see their home-bred Triple Crown winner-the first in 25 years since Citation, how the New York crowd booed the city mayor when he tried to cash in on the celebrations and how Penny's only concern halfway through the final leg was that jockey Ron Turcotte might fall off!
